| Formula | C20H26O3 |
| Net Charge | 0 |
| Average Mass | 314.425 |
| Monoisotopic Mass | 314.18819 |
| SMILES | CC/C=C\C/C=C/C=C1/C(=O)C=C[C@@H]1C/C=C\CCCC(=O)O |
| InChI | InChI=1S/C20H26O3/c1-2-3-4-5-6-10-13-18-17(15-16-19(18)21)12-9-7-8-11-14-20(22)23/h3-4,6-7,9-10,13,15-17H,2,5,8,11-12,14H2,1H3,(H,22,23)/b4-3-,9-7-,10-6+,18-13+/t17-/m0/s1 |
| InChIKey | QFTYCAAGCUOJNG-KRXWQEJVSA-N |

| 15-deoxy-Δ12,14-prostaglandin J3 (CHEBI:140223) has role human xenobiotic metabolite (CHEBI:76967) |
| 15-deoxy-Δ12,14-prostaglandin J3 (CHEBI:140223) has role mouse metabolite (CHEBI:75771) |
| 15-deoxy-Δ12,14-prostaglandin J3 (CHEBI:140223) is a prostaglandins J (CHEBI:26346) |
| 15-deoxy-Δ12,14-prostaglandin J3 (CHEBI:140223) is conjugate acid of 15-deoxy-Δ12,14-prostaglandin J3(1−) (CHEBI:140283) |

| IUPAC Name |
|---|
| (5Z)-7-{(1S,5E)-5-[(2E,5Z)-octa-2,5-dien-1-ylidene]-4-oxocyclopent-2-en-1-yl}hept-5-enoic acid |
| Synonyms | Source |
|---|---|
| 15d-PGJ3 | SUBMITTER |
| 15-deoxyprostaglandin J3 | ChEBI |
| 15-deoxy-δ(12,14)-prostaglandin J3 | ChEBI |
| (5Z,12E,14E,17Z)-11-oxoprosta-5,9,12,14,17-pentaen-1-oic acid | ChEBI |
